//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Unlock Enchanting Savings with Genieplay Promo Code Magic - Acacia
loader

Unlock Enchanting Savings with Genieplay Promo Code Magic

Introduction

In the enchanted world of online gaming, few platforms offer the thrill and excitement of Genieplay Casino. With a plethora of games and enticing bonuses, this casino has captured the hearts of players worldwide. One of the most magical aspects of Genieplay is the ability to enhance your gaming experience through the use of the Genieplay promo code. Let’s embark on a journey to uncover how you can unlock enchanting savings and maximize your fun.

About Genieplay Casino

Genieplay Casino is a premier online gaming destination, known for its user-friendly interface, attractive design, and a wide array of games that cater to all types of players. Established with the goal of providing an unparalleled gaming experience, Genieplay combines state-of-the-art technology with engaging gameplay.

Key features include:

  • A vast selection of slots, table games, and live dealer options
  • Generous bonuses and promotional offers
  • High-quality graphics and sound effects
  • Safe and secure payment methods

Benefits of Using the Genieplay Promo Code

The Genieplay promo code is your ticket to elevating your gaming experience. Here’s how it works:

  • Exclusive Bonuses: Unlock special offers such as free spins or deposit matches that are only available with promo codes.
  • Enhanced Gameplay: Benefit from increased funds in your account, allowing you to play more games and try out new titles without risk.
  • Boosted Winning Potential: With additional credits or spins, you increase your chances of hitting that jackpot!
  • Easy Redemption: Using a promo code is simple, making it accessible even for novice players.

How to Use the Genieplay Promo Code

Utilizing genieplayireland.com the Genieplay promo code is a straightforward process. Follow these steps to ensure you take full advantage of the promo:

  1. Create Your Account: If you’re a new player, visit the Genieplay Casino website and sign up.
  2. Locate the Promo Code Field: During the registration process or when making your first deposit, look for the area designated for entering your promo code.
  3. Enter the Code: Input the unique Genieplay promo code you have to unlock the benefits.
  4. Complete Your Deposit: Finalize your transaction to activate the bonus associated with the code.
  5. Enjoy Your Games: Dive into the exciting world of Genieplay with your enhanced balance!

Diverse Game Selection at Genieplay Casino

One of the standout features of Genieplay Casino is its impressive game library. Players can explore a myriad of options, including:

Game Type Description Popular Titles
Slots Engaging video slots with various themes and mechanics. Starburst, Book of Dead, Gonzo’s Quest
Table Games Classic casino games that require strategy and skill. Blackjack, Roulette, Baccarat
Live Dealer Games Real-time gaming experience with professional dealers. Live Blackjack, Live Roulette

The diverse selection ensures that every player, from beginners to seasoned pros, can find something they enjoy. And with the promo code, you can explore even more games without stretching your budget.

Customer Support at Genieplay

Good customer support is vital in the online gaming world, and Genieplay excels in this aspect. The support team is available 24/7 to assist players with any queries or issues they may encounter.

Support options include:

  • Live Chat: Instant assistance for urgent inquiries.
  • Email Support: For detailed questions or feedback.
  • Help Center: A comprehensive resource filled with FAQs and guides.

This dedication to customer service ensures that players can focus on what they enjoy most—having fun!

Conclusion

In the captivating realm of online casinos, Genieplay Casino stands out as a beacon of entertainment. By leveraging the Genieplay promo code, you can unlock a treasure trove of benefits that enhance your overall gaming experience. Whether you’re spinning the reels of your favorite slot game or strategizing at the blackjack table, the added bonuses can lead to thrilling wins.

So why wait? Dive into the magical world of Genieplay today, use your promo code, and let the adventures begin!